About The Salvation Army – Adult Rehabilitation Center – Honolulu
The Salvation Army has an Adult Rehabilitation Center located in Honolulu, Hawaii. This facility offers treatment to men between the ages of 21 to 65 who are struggling with substance abuse disorders. They’re a work therapy and faith based treatment center. The level of care offered at this facility is residential treatment and the duration of stay is typically up to one hundred and eighty days. While you are here they provide spiritual counseling, work therapy, help you develop work as well as social skills, and help you develop stability.
Residential care at this facility is available at no cost to you. Some fees may accrue for specialized services.
Upon arrival at this facility, they’ll require you to take a breathalyzer and a drug test and it is required to participate in all the program activities and have the ability to work at most eight hours a day. This is to help you learn to develop a healthy day to day structure and learn to manage responsibilities like employment and more importantly learning to also take time to care for yourself.
Their faith-based approach will help you create or strengthen a stronger connection to God and improve your spiritual wellness. They also have worship services and counseling sessions that will be part of your treatment plan weekly. This is a holistic approach and can help you gain a better understanding of yourself and others as well as your journey in recovery.
Work therapy at this facility will help increase productivity and more importantly it can help you strengthen your social and communication skills with others. This can also help strengthen employment opportunities.
